Sweet potatoes are a powerhouse of nutrition, rich in vitamins A and C, potassium, and fiber. Their vibrant orange flesh is indicative of their high beta-carotene content, which is essential for maintaining good vision and immune function. Additionally, sweet potatoes have a lower glycemic index than regular potatoes, making them a smart choice for those looking to manage their blood sugar levels.

Crispy Cajun Sweet Potato Fries

Ingredients
  

2 large sweet potatoes

2 tablespoons olive oil

1 teaspoon garlic powder

1 teaspoon onion powder

1 teaspoon smoked paprika

1 teaspoon cayenne pepper (adjust for spice preference)

1 teaspoon dried oregano

1 teaspoon salt

½ teaspoon black pepper

Optional: Fresh parsley, for garnish

Instructions
 

Preheat the Oven: Preheat your oven to 425°F (220°C). Line a large baking sheet with parchment paper for easy cleanup.

    Prepare the Sweet Potatoes: Wash and peel the sweet potatoes. Cut them into thin, uniform fries (about 1/4 thick) to ensure even cooking.

      Toss with Oil and Spices: In a large bowl, combine the sweet potato fries with olive oil, garlic powder, onion powder, smoked paprika, cayenne pepper, oregano, salt, and black pepper. Toss well until every fry is evenly coated with the oil and spices.

        Arrange the Fries: Spread the sweet potato fries in a single layer on the prepared baking sheet. Make sure they are not overcrowded; use two baking sheets if necessary to ensure crispiness.

          Bake the Fries: Bake in the preheated oven for about 25-30 minutes, or until the fries are golden brown and crispy, flipping them halfway through cooking for even browning.

            Final Touch: Once baked, remove from the oven and let them cool for a few minutes. Season them with a little extra salt, if desired, and garnish with fresh parsley if using.

              Serve: Serve hot with your favorite dipping sauce, such as ranch dressing, spicy mayo, or ketchup.

                Prep Time, Total Time, Servings: 15 min | 35 min | 4 servings
